iOS 7 Update Plugs Lock Screen Security Hole
by Staff •
Apple released an update to iOS 7 on Thursday that aims to repair a security flaw: a lock-screen bypass that allows a user to call any contact without unlocking the phone. The notes that accompany the iOS 7.0.2 update say it “fixes bugs that could allow someone to bypass the Lock screen passcode.” Mashable staffers…

Apple’s Developer Portal Hacked, Awaits Overhaul
by Staff •
Apple‘s developer portal has been hacked on Thursday. An intruder managed to obtain some personal info from registered developers, Apple has announced. “Last Thursday, an intruder attempted to secure personal information of our registered developers from our developer website.
